DD-02 PHARMACODYNAMIC BIOMARKER ASSESSMENTS IN A PHASE I/II TRIAL OF THE HYPOXIA-ACTIVATED PRODRUG TH-302 AND BEVACIZUMAB IN BEVACIZUMAB-REFRACTORY RECURRENT GLIOBLASTOMA
BACKGROUND: Glioblastoma (GBM) remains an incurable malignancy with rapid progression and poor survival. GBM exhibits a hypoxic nature, and treatment with bevacizumab (BEV) may increase intratumoral hypoxia. TH-302 is an investigational prodrug that selectively releases the DNA cross-linker (Br-IPM)...
